A beta tester sent this last week:
"Voice telling me inaccurate distances before turns. Quoting
metres when ft is what's displayed on screen."
Opened the code. Voice generator was hardcoded to metres,
regardless of the user's units pref.
Fixed in v1.2.5. Imperial users now hear "in 200 yards" / "in
a quarter mile" — matching what they see.
Beta reports → real fixes → next build. The loop works.
